7 Things to Look Out for in Outsourcing Partner
1. Strategic Perspective
A strategic outsourcing partner will gain an understanding of current business conditions and build on that to provide creative and innovative outsourcing solutions that tie together with your business objectives.
2. Level of Technological Advancement
Technology is a significant consideration when choosing a service provider for your outsourcing needs. Any business that wants to retain a competitive advantage must invest in relevant technology to improve business processes. This is a good way of assessing the extent of their capabilities.
3. Client-centricity
A client-centric outsourcing provider is focused on creating a positive business experience for its customers by maximising resources and improving business performance. Such service provider will assign you a dedicated account manager who will ensure that all your business needs for the outsourced functions are met.
4. Employee Care
Happier and healthier employees are shown to regularly outperform those who are in organisations which do not promote health and wellbeing. Your outsourcing partner must show that they provide primary care for their staff.
5. Risk Management
A reliable service provider should be able to identify possible sources of catastrophic risk, measure potential effects on the business and then select appropriate countermeasures that may prevent or mitigate the effects.
